Trader Joe's Is Expanding Across Central Florida… But Ocala Was Left Off the List Again
While neighboring Central Florida cities welcome new Trader Joe's locations, Ocala and Marion County residents continue waiting for their turn. New stores recently opened in Daytona Beach and Melbourne, bringing Florida's total to 27 locations—but none in our community yet.

Why Trader Joe's Chooses Some Cities Over Others
What Drives Expansion Decisions
Trader Joe's doesn't select new locations randomly. Their real estate team analyzes multiple factors including population density, household income levels, competition analysis, and most importantly—direct customer demand signals.
Every store request submitted through their official form is tracked and reviewed. Cities with higher submission volumes demonstrate measurable interest, which directly influences expansion priorities.
The Data Behind the Decision
Customer request form submissions
Population growth trends and demographics
Real estate availability and site feasibility
Proximity to existing locations
Local economic indicators
No formal announcement for Ocala means the company is still measuring demand levels in our area.

Why a Trader Joe's Means More Than Just Groceries
Economic Development Signal
Major retailers track where competitors expand. A Trader Joe's often catalyzes additional commercial investment and signals that an area has reached critical mass for specialty retail.
Property Value Impact
Neighborhoods near Trader Joe's locations frequently see positive effects on home values. The convenience factor and perceived lifestyle upgrade make nearby properties more attractive to buyers.
Quality of Life Enhancement
Access to specialty grocers improves daily convenience and dining options. For many families and retirees, it's a key amenity when choosing where to live in Central Florida.
Retail expansion patterns reveal broader economic trends. When established brands like Trader Joe's enter a market, they validate population growth, income levels, and long-term community viability—factors that matter to everyone, not just shoppers.
Marion County's Growth Story: The Data That Supports Demand
Rapid Population Expansion
Marion County has experienced significant population growth over the past decade, driven by affordable housing, quality of life, and proximity to major Florida metros. New residential developments continue breaking ground across Ocala and surrounding areas.
The demographic mix includes young families attracted by housing affordability, retirees seeking Florida's lifestyle benefits, and professionals working remotely. This diversity creates the exact consumer base that specialty retailers target.
Housing & Commercial Development
Ongoing construction of master-planned communities, shopping centers, and mixed-use developments demonstrates developer confidence in the area's trajectory. Infrastructure improvements and business relocations further validate the region's economic momentum.
